Ableton Note is a note-taking and productivity app designed for music producers, DJs, and other creative professionals. It allows users to easily capture ideas, streamline workflows, and organize projects while producing music in Ableton Live.
SampleWiz is a user-friendly data sampling and analysis tool. It allows you to easily extract samples from large datasets, visualize distributions, perform statistical analysis, and generate reports.
